About Toronto FC

Toronto FC were MLS's most passionate expansion story, a club that arrived in 2007 and immediately generated supporter culture that the league had rarely seen. Difficult early years gave way to genuine glory when Sebastian Giovinco arrived in 2015 and transformed the club into MLS's most exciting side. The 2017 MLS Cup triumph was the crowning moment, backed by a BMO Field crowd that creates some of the most intense atmospheres in North American sport. Toronto have always done it their own way and that has made them special. Founded in 2005, Toronto FC play at BMO Field and compete in MLS Eastern Conference. Key honours include the 2017 MLS Cup and two Canadian Championships. Known as TFC, the club wears red as their signature colour and is one of Canadian football's most passionate and followed clubs. Red is Toronto FC and it has been worn with extraordinary passion from the very beginning. The 2017 MLS Cup winning shirt, worn as Victor Vazquez and Jozy Altidore powered TFC to the first Canadian club championship in MLS history, is the standout piece of the modern collection. The Giovinco-era kits from 2015-19 carry enormous nostalgic weight. Adidas has supplied clean red home shirts in recent years. The black away kits with red trim suit the intensity of a fanbase that has always demanded excellence.
